Output 80d704d1da9844ec221013cd278120414d8169f950ca653b04552980ccda4b9c:0

value
10944088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0383dac6ce4c838b1face350e3e7668e83391465 OP_EQUAL
address
321buY7MWVqTPYxY48EqyHcFeyZj4K2hip
transaction
80d704d1da9844ec221013cd278120414d8169f950ca653b04552980ccda4b9c
spent
true